In the very beginning I would always use too much pressure and too high of an angle. I finally have the angle where I am comfortable but I still find myself using too much pressure from time to time, I sometimes use too much pressure with the DE to. I just try to be more conscience of it.
After getting more comfortable with the angle and pressure my problem turned into patience. I would start off with a great shave then think I could do the rest of my face and that was almost always a big mistake. Cuts and razor burn would usually follow. In the forums I would read people saying to do just a little then stop until you are comfortable shaving more, I was too stubborn for that :shrug:. I started going back to the videos and one I recently watched was Lynn suggesting the same thing, do just a little and STOP:nono:.
I have been using this method for about two weeks along with using both hands, being a righty using my left hand is extremely awkward but I am getting used to it. So far things are progressing very nicely. I only shave a maximum of 3x per week so I will force myself to do this for at least another month before going forward.
